Statistics: Difference between revisions
From Crumbled World Wiki
(Created page with "{{:StatisticsExampleCode}} ==Constructor== {| class="wikitable" !|function !|description |- |Statistics() | |- |} ==Functions== {| class="wikitable" !|return !|function !|description |- | |addScriptGroup(string groupName, string scriptNames) |scriptNames are seperated by ';' example skeleton.lua;rat.lua |- | |update() |Calculate previous frame statistics |- |float |Statistics:...") |
(No difference)
|
Latest revision as of 07:29, 5 August 2025
Constructor
| function | description |
|---|---|
| Statistics() |
Functions
| return | function | description |
|---|---|---|
| addScriptGroup(string groupName, string scriptNames) | scriptNames are seperated by ';' example skeleton.lua;rat.lua | |
| update() | Calculate previous frame statistics | |
| float | getAverageThreadTime() | |
| float | getMinThreadTime() | |
| float | getMaxThreadTime() | |
| float | getAverageNumWork() | |
| number | getNumThreads() | |
| {time=number,maxTime=number,minTime=number,scriptCount=number} | getScriptGroupStatistics(string groupName) | |
| {time=number,maxTime=number,minTime=number,scriptCount=number} | getUngroupedScriptStatistics() | |
| string | getUngroupedScriptNames() |